Caldecott Medal The Caldecott Medal is awarded annually by the Association for Library Service to Children (ALSC), a division of the American Library Association, to the artist of the most distinguished American picture book for children.
|
|
2 |
The Newbery Medal The Newbery Medal is awarded annually by the same division of the ALA to the author of the most distinguished contribution to American literature for children.
|
|
3 |
Coretta Scott King Award A committee of the American Library Association presents this award to authors and illustrators of African descent whose distinguished books represent "the American Dream."
|
|
4 |
Boston Globe-Horn Book Award The Boston Globe-Horn Book Awards recognize works of fiction, poetry, and nonfiction published in the U.S.
